Tig welding titanium is a massive pain in the ass, which is why it will be difficult to find anyone. The big problem for an exhaust is back purging, which is filling up the exhaust with argon gas (any oxygen near the weld will ruin it), so the exhaust will have to be off the bike. Then it requires specialist tig accessories to provide a big enough argon gas "shield" to displace the oxygen and titanium filler wire. it has to be titanium to titanium/titanium alloy or it will not work due to the different melting temperatures.
hope this provides some insight
